What Are Odd and Even Numbers?
Even numbers are integers that are exactly divisible by 2, meaning they end in 0, 2, 4, 6, or 8. Odd numbers, on the other hand, leave a remainder of 1 when divided by 2, and thus end in 1, 3, 5, 7, or 9. This classification applies universally and forms the basis of many mathematical concepts, including divisibility, patterns, and modular arithmetic.
Odd Numbers from 1 to 6: 1, 3, 5
Key Insights
Let’s examine the odd numbers in the range 1 to 6:
- 1: Not divisible by 2; when divided, it leaves a remainder of 1 → odd.
- 2: Divisible by 2 → even.
- 3: Not divisible by 2; leaves remainder 1 → odd.
- 4: Divisible by 2 → even.
- 5: Not divisible by 2; leaves remainder 1 → odd.
- 6: Divisible by 2 → even.
Thus, the odd numbers in this range are 1, 3, and 5—a clear set of three numbers, each odd.

Why This Split Matters in Math
Understanding odd and even numbers is essential because:
- It helps in recognizing patterns in basic arithmetic.
- It supports divisibility rules.
- It plays a role in number theory, coding, and cryptography.
- It’s foundational for teaching children early math skills.
